Read MoreThe Trust for the National Mall recently sat down with artist Suzanne Firstenberg to reflect on her powerful and emotional exhibition, “In America: Remember,” one year after its installation on the National Mall. From September 17 to October 3, 2021, over 700 ,000 white flags were planted on the grounds of the Washington Monument, across from the White House ellipse, to memorialize the American lives lost to the COVID-19 pandemic.
